[0268] Figures 1-23 show a preferred embodiment of the present invention in relation to a computer mouse input device by designing a base 2 with a completely planar lower surface (in addition to the embodiments described in Figures 6 and 20) and a protrusion 3 protruding completely upward from the bottom 2 . The embodiment exemplified in FIGS. 1-5 shows a device 1 optimized for use by right-handed users and comprising an extended thumb-engaging surface 4 on a first side of said protrusion 3 and an index fingertip engaging surface 5 and a middle fingertip engaging surface 6 on a side of the protrusion 3 opposite to said thumb engaging surface 4 . Alternative embodiments designed for left-handed users and ambidextrous embodiments are also possible as shown more fully below.
